K20 Engines Unique Structure



While many engines boast impressive specifications, it is the unique framework of the K20 engine that sets it apart. Honda, the manufacturer, designed this engine as component of the K-series, which are four-cylinder, four-stroke engines. The K20, especially, includes an aluminum cylinder block with a cast iron cyndrical tube lining. Its small structure is remarkable for its high-revving nature, which is sustained by a twin expenses camshaft (DOHC) style. This DOHC design, combined with the VTEC system (Variable Shutoff Timing and Lift Electronic Control), ensures reliable gas combustion and a broad powerband. Such a thought about framework is among the reasons the K20 engine has gotten a track record for its high performance and reliability.

The Technical Requirements of the K20 Engine



K20 EngineK20 Engine
Although the K20 engine may appear unassuming at first look, its technological specs tell a different tale. Made by Honda, the K20 is available in different iterations, with one of the most effective being the K20A. This particular variant flaunts a displacement of 1998cc, a bore and stroke of 86mm x 86mm, and a compression proportion of 11.5:1. This four-cylinder DOHC i-VTEC engine likewise includes a redline of 8400 RPM, therefore showcasing its high-revving nature. Notable for its cutting-edge style, the K20 engine employs a chain-driven camshaft and roller rockers to reduce rubbing and improve performance. With these specs, it is clear that the K20 engine is a well-engineered piece of equipment, created for performance and integrity.

Design Features Enhancing Performance



Regardless of its small dimension, the K20 engine flaunts several design functions that dramatically enhance its performance. Understood for its high-revving nature, it utilizes a twin expenses camshaft (DOHC) layout, which enables much better shutoff control and greater efficiency at faster rates. The execution of Honda's i-VTEC system further maximizes valve timing, adding to the K20's remarkable power result. A significantly square bore and stroke ratio aids in accomplishing an equilibrium in between torque and horse power. This engine likewise includes a light-weight, die-cast light weight aluminum block that lowers total weight, bring about boosted vehicle dynamics and velocity capacities. These layout components function with each other, making the K20 a standout entertainer in its course. K20 Engine.

Usual Applications and Use the K20 Engine



K20 EngineK20 Engine
Renowned for its convenience, the K20 engine discovers its place in a selection of applications. At first designed for Honda's portable automobiles, this engine quickly obtained popularity for its efficiency and dependability. K20 Engine. It found its means into a lot of Honda's high-performance cars, consisting of the Civic Type R and the Acura RSX Kind S. Additionally, the K20 has been extensively used in the motorsport sector. Its high-revving nature and robust building make it a favored among competing fanatics. Additionally, it is a preferred choice for engine swaps because of its compatibility with a variety of chassis. Whether in daily motorists, high-performance cars, or race cars, the K20 engine has actually proven its worth across several systems.
